All the tracks around here that do any good have a little bit of all it going on. Ask any of the small tire guys , All you have to do is back the power down a little add a box. http://bham.craigslist.org/cto/4538265829.htmlYou have a instant bracket car. Last time I had mine out it went three back to back 5.62's on motor. With a complete nos tune To run a small tire car you have to have a base line and turn it up from there. Any body who grudge races or heads up races knows what you can run on a given tune. As you get close to the edge the things are more likely to happen. Just a lot more than a bunch of thugs doing stab and steer.

I don't go to the track for the BBQ. I actually enjoy running my car and one pass doesn't do it.

I do enjoy the heads up stuff, although grudge ain't my cup of tea. I don't knock another guy's type of racing...there's an ass for every seat, and it's all in point of view. Example: One Staurday at the track, I had a guy constantly coming to my pit, trying to goad me into a grudge race while I was qualifying for the electronics race. He got tired of me turning him down, and said, "I think you're just scared of going fast."
I said, "Well it sounds to me like you have no idea what your car's gonna do." He said, "Oh, yes I do." I said, "Well, good....write it on your window and meet me in the staging lanes." He declined.

It's all point of view...and it's all racing. For me, I like a lot of laps...like today, if the weather holds out, our sissy bracket race pays $5000 to win, with payouts down to quarterfinals.
